Siemens Digital Industries Software Head of IT Transformation in St. Louis, Missouri

Job Family: Information Technology

Req ID: 414005

General Summary of the Job:

The Head of IT Transformation at Siemens Industry Software is leading all IT transformation resources. These consist of several teams that cover Demand Management, Architecture and Project Team. These teams are responsible to drive all major transformation activities where IT supports the business to make them happen. The role includes budget responsibility for all assigned transformation projects and will include considerable support by external partners. Beside leading managers within the Transformation team, the role also requires extensive collaboration with stakeholders on the business side. These include the top executives of DI SW and potentially for some projects beyond. Overall this role requires great management as well as communication skills.

Essential Functions:

The Head of IT Transformation will be responsible for leading a team of people managers (8-12 managers) and highly skilled experts (100-120 individuals) including project managers and:

  • Creates IT value for our businesses by taking end-to-end responsibility for the assigned Projects and initiatives, which are decisive for the future success of DI SW and therefore have direct business impact.

  • Has excellent communication skills based on thorough IT understanding to be able to be a trustworthy partner of the business executives

  • Manages initiatives, projects and costs proactively and keeps an constant eye on true business benefits and business stakeholder satisfaction.

  • Manages a sizeable team that drives innovations and that believes in continuous improvement, likes to be empowered, and believes in the value of collaboration.

  • Is able to deal with changing priorities and an everchanging environment (VUCA).

  • Optimizes external service provider management to deal with work peaks and knows how to manage and leverage them.

  • Has a strong business orientation that helps to identify and focus on IT initiatives that provide the most value to the business

  • Is an important member of the senior IT management team and helps drive IT to success

  • Collaborate closely with IT management and IT Operations to ensure smooth handover of new systems and functions to daily operation
